FMBN, Shelter Afrique sign $2bn deal to build 100,000 homes    

… 150,000 jobs to be created In an innovative effort to reduce the housing deficit of 17 million homes in Nigeria and accelerate home ownership among Nigerians, the Federal Mortgage Bank of Nigeria (FMBN) last week in Abuja signed a $2 billion memorandum of understanding (MoU) with Company for Habitat in Africa (Shelter Afrique) and…
